# Context for weekly eng sync: Corvette-7 fd leak hunt.
# Descriptor counts on the Mapletide export workers grow ~200/hr under load.
# Suspect: unclosed temp handles in the archive writer; fix candidate in branch fd-audit.
# Action before sync: run the audit script against staging, dump per-process fd snapshots
# into the diagnostics table, and note any pools exceeding threshold.
# The script reads its target database from the setting directly below.

replica DSN, kajep-yahag: mssql://praok_svc:iF@db-8d68.plorvaio.local:5432/eliion

**CI note: Pagewarden doc linter flaking**

Pagewarden fails intermittently on the Thornfield docs repo when heading anchors exceed 80 chars. Not a parser bug — the sandbox truncates temp filenames. Pin the linter to the previous minor until the sandbox fix lands. Reruns usually pass, which hides the issue. The failing trace is referenced below.

session token of tajef-bageg = htk21_5d90d574934f3ccae6437

Handover — log sampling on Chattervane. For release manager review before Friday's cut. Chattervane emits ~40k lines/min at INFO; we enabled tail sampling last sprint so only errors and 2% of INFO survive. Dashboards already rebuilt against sampled volume, so don't panic at the drop. Mira owns the sampler sidecar; I own the shipper. Rollback is a single flag flip, no restart needed. The sampler reads the following values at boot, so apply them exactly as listed below.

settings of tagef-bawif:
DRUIX_HOST=druix.zemvarlabs.internal
DRUIX_PORT=8000